Transaction 639264ab70ee7f0844f6e7a2e012efc99060eb8605d0532f3f81890c04c5a153
1 Input
1 Output
-
639264ab70ee7f0844f6e7a2e012efc99060eb8605d0532f3f81890c04c5a153:0
- value
- 3394066
- script pubkey
- OP_0 OP_PUSHBYTES_20 a77c17ed8d5e07c1b265faf4aac7eb5e02cf152c
- address
- bc1q5a7p0mvdtcrurvn9lt6243lttcpv79fv8xw5ua